Take Breaks! A Simple Way to Improve Your Heuristic Evaluation Results (11 Jun 2005)
The moral of this story? You may find yourself more effective in performing heuristic or expert evaluations if you divide them into sections and take breaks between to refresh your thinking. The approach used in the studies was to divide the heuristics themselves into sets. Using those smaller sets of criteria per session, work for an hour, then get away for 30 minutes or more, whether on a complete break or simply to another type of task. You may find that each time you begin it is with the freshness of mind of a whole new evaluation.
